Freedom Convoy: Canada trucker protests force car plant shutdowns

  • Image source, Reuters Image caption, Protesters blocked the last entrance to the Ambassador Bridge on the US border on Wednesday Two of the world's biggest carmakers, Ford and Toyota, say production is being disrupted by trucker protests in Canada.
  • Truckers blocking the most important border crossing, the Ambassador Bridge, waved Canadian flags and banners denouncing Prime Minister Justin Trudeau, who has refused to scrap a rule requiring truckers entering Canada to be fully immunised against coronavirus.
  • The Ambassador Bridge is the largest international suspension bridge in the world and carries about a quarter of US-Canada trade.
  • The White House has called for an end to the protests, saying they risk hurting the car industry and US agricultural exports.
